Introducing Instrumented Education

Because of of the flood of smart devices and tablets entering classrooms, we have an opportunity to teach in new ways. Often, teachers use these devices to download streaming media to support ideas, engage students in applications that make drilling on content more fun, and as a resource for looking up data. The problem that may occur in the pedagogical method is that as we leverage these devices more, we move from empirical confirmation like working on a real frog to working on a simulated frog. It's certainly more convenient to work on a digital frog. It minimizes the logistics, the storage, the safety issues. But the digital frog cannot offer the same confirmation of reality the way a real frog can.

It is not as though these smart devices force the teaching style in those directions. Indeed on many smart devices the gyroscope, hall effect sensor, accelerometer, infrared-capable camera, infrared proximity sensor, microphone, and speaker can open up a whole new world of instrumentation to the classroom. Students can begin to sense the unseen world of electromagnetism, sound, acceleration, and more in a quantifiable and instrumented way that confirms details of the natural world.

Creating a sense of accessibility and tangibility of sensor-based reality on the small and local scale of the device is important in helping students understand how modern science is done on large scales with sensor grids spanning the globe, remote devices streaming vast quantities of data, and the farthest reaches of our human understanding being informed with digital sensors. To understand this on a local level is to be empowered to engage it in depth on a larger level.

This site is devoted to helping students and educators identify apps (applications) for smart devices that can leverage the potential of new smart devices as the powerful data collection devices they are, packed with sensor arrays and full of analytical, presentation, and storage capabilities.
